A.E. “Peter” Pierce, age 90, of the Helena community, passed away peacefully on May 24, 2025.
He was preceded in death by his parents, Lloyd “Dub” Pierce and Frances Evelyn “Dixie” Pierce; a brother, Louis Vice; and a grandson, Dustin Eugene Pierce.
He is survived by his loving wife, Helen Grace Elkins Pierce; his children, Teresa (Gene) Emswiler and Danny (Pam) Pierce; a sister, Mary Agnes (Ronnie) Carpenter; his grandchildren, Andrea (Chris) Sherman, Lauren (Michael) Watson, Heath (Rachell) Pierce, Ashley (Josh) Pierce, Jesse (Krista) Pierce, and Leah Daughdrill; his great-grandchildren, Alex Hardwick, Bella Sherman, Gracie Pierce Watson, Parker Pierce, Abby Pierce, Annie Watson, Emma Pierce, Tanner Sherman, Logan Pierce, Cora Beth Watson, Charlie Pierce, Lane Pierce, Parker Williams, and Jaxon Williams; and numerous other relatives and friends.
Mr. Pierce was a lifelong resident of the Helena Community and attended Moss Point High School. He served honorably in the U.S. Army during the Korean War and was discharged as a Specialist 3(T) while stationed at Ft. Bliss, Texas. While in the Army, he received the National Defense Service Medal, Good Conduct Medal, United Nations Service Medal, Korean Service Medal, and the Meritorious Unit Citation. Following his discharge in 1956, Peter returned to Jackson County and spent time working at Ingalls Shipbuilding, Vice Construction, Jackson County Road Department, and was the owner/operator of Gulf Coast Fuel. He also served as a Jackson County Supervisor in Beat 1.
He was charter member of the Escatawpa Assembly of God Church and served faithfully in several capacities his entire life. He was a mean softball player, solid baseball coach, and loved to fish, hunt, and cheer on his Ole Miss Rebels.
